Chapter 6: The Power of Doing Good or Evil

 

Q. What do you understand by your belief in the power of doing good or evil proceeding from Allah and Allah alone?
A. I mean that Allah has given me the power of action (good or bad), but He has also given me reason and a code of life to choose between good and evil, and therefore, I am responsible for my actions. For example, Allah has given me the power of speaking. It is for me to use tongue for speaking the truth or abuse its power by speaking lies.
Q. How does Allah help you to do good acts?
A. Allah helps us to do good acts by sending Messengers to guide us all along the right path, and Codes of Relegion.
Q. What is a sin?
A. Any action against the Commands of Allah is a sin
Q. Who can forgive sin?
A. Allah and Allah alone can forgive sins.
Q. What should you do, so that allah may forgive your sins?
A. In order that my sins be forgiven, I must pray to Allah with all my heart and, atoning for all my evil deeds, resolve never to commit any such or other misdeeds again.
Q. Witch articles of food and drink have been decreed unlaw for a muslim?
A. The articles of food and drink that have been decreed un law full for a muslim are:

1.All kinds of , liquintoxicating winesors and sprits.
2. Flesh of swine and wild animals that employ claws or teeth for killing their vicitims, e.g., tigers, leopards, elephants, wolves, etc., and all birds of prey as hawks, eagles, vultures, crows, etc.
3. Rodents, reptiles, worms, etc.,
4. Flesh of dead animals that are otherwise sanctioned as legitimate.
5. Flesh of animals and birds (sanctioned) that are not slaughtered or slayed in the prescribed manner.
6. Flesh of animals that are offered as sacrifice to idols.
